Schneider Digitar lens series
![]() |
|
This complete series of digital photographic lenses, with a focal length range of 28 to 150 mm, has been specially designed to meet the needs of digital photography. It provides the ultra-high resolution required by today's CCD sensors, and by the next generation as well. This assures the highest possible image quality. With the introduction of DIGITAR lenses, SCHNEIDER-KREUZNACH makes it possible, for the first time, for professional photographers to work with a complete series of photographic lenses especially designed and manufactured for digital photography. In developing these unique lenses, SCHNEIDER-KREUZNACH draws upon the highest performance characteristics of its many world-famous lenses, supplemented by extensive research, development and design involving digital imaging technology. As a result, the imaging capabilities of DIGITAR lenses are so great that they meet the highest resolution requirements of today's CCD imaging sensors as well as those of the new sensors being designed now for release in the next decade. With models including the WA-DIGITAR 2.8/28 wide angle lens,the standard focal length DIGITAR 47 through 150mm lenses,and the M-DIGITAR 5.6/80 and 5.6/120 macro lenses,the complete DIGITAR series covers a broad spectrum of applications. As with all SCHNEIDER large format lenses, DIGITAR lenses offer outstanding clarity and sharpness over their entire image fields.Their large image circles enable all the tilt and shift adjustments of professional studio cameras to be used in digital photography. This ensures that professional photographers can meet all their quality requirements whenever they shoot with high resolution digital backs. Furthermore, because DIGITAR lenses also provide outstanding, superior imaging quality with standard photographic film, photographers now need purchase only one set of lenses to have the best of both worlds. |
